Modeling the M(t)/M/s(t) Queue with an Exhaustive Discipline

The M/M/s queueing model assumes arrival rates, service rates, and number of servers to be constant in time. It is straightforward to extend the model to allow a time-varying arrival rate and a time-varying service rate, and the resulting models can be solved numerically using standard solvers for ordinary differential equations. The extension to a time-varying number of servers requires consideration of the behavior of a server that is providing service when scheduled to leave. Past work has (implicitly or explicitly) assumed a pre-emptive discipline, where the customer rejoins the queue. We demonstrate how to model an exhaustive discipline that is often more realistic, where servers complete their current service before leaving. We discuss how to compute the virtual waiting time distribution for this model and outline its extension to incorporate customer abandonments.
